About The Position

We are looking for someone with business protection experience or knowledge to join our team. This is a remote role but does require occasional travel to clients and our offices in the Southwest of England. Our Business Protection Advisors are a key part of our business, speaking to our clients and providing advice on all aspects of business protection, including key person protection, shareholder protection, executive income protection, loan protection and relevant life cover.
